Saving projects
You say 'it appears as one of my projects'.
Presumably therefore, this Project is listed in the File > Project Window.
If you click the Help button there is plenty of advice.
Just click on the Project's name to highlight it, and click the Open Project button.
While selected, use More Tasks > Default Project to make it the default Project to open automatically when you run FH.
